The street in brief

Basil Terrace is mostly ter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£165,000 — roughly 49% below the ME15 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; ME15 prices as a whole have been easing. HM Land Registry records 9 sales across 5 homes since 2001 — homes here come up rarely.

Basil Terrace's £165,000 median sits about 49% below ME15's £325,000.

Street and ME15 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
